Overview: Train from Venlo to Wiesbaden
Trains from Venlo to Wiesbaden run on average 22 times per day, taking around 3h 38m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at $75 (€60) but you can travel from only $31 (€25) by bus.
The earliest train runs at 00:03, the last at 23:39. The fastest train covers the 127 miles (205 km) distance in 4h 8m.

Regional trains (RE / RB / S-Bahn):
No onboard catering.
You’re welcome to bring your own food and drinks.
Not included by default.
You can add a seat reservation when booking (recommended for busy routes).
Costs around €4.90 per seat (or €5.90 if booked separately later).
First Class:
Yes, always included in the ticket price.
Allowed for free if they can fit in a transport box (max. size: hand luggage).
Must stay in the box for the entire journey.
Large dogs:
Require a separate (paid) ticket — typically half the price of a regular second-class ticket.
Must be leashed and wear a muzzle while on the train.
Cannot sit on seats.
Assistance dogs:
Travel free of charge.
Do not need a muzzle or leash if medically not required.
Allowed to accompany the passenger at all times.
